As an editor of boxrec I have uploaded thousands of fights during the last twenty years. I am interested in reconstructing the amateur records of two of Chicago's greatest amateurs: Ben Black and Frank Steele.
Black was the dominant amateur heavyweight in the early sixties, winning a national title and having a short, overmatched pro career in which he was stopped by Cleveland Williams.
Steele from Gary, Indiana won 4 Chicago GG titles and knocked out Earnie Shavers in the amateurs. As a pro he went 5-0 but retired due to an eye injury.
